Output 6a066468edcae42fc3184527618fa1ef80339b84a6dc4f536d05beae69cf47a4:5

value
8665400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c99b0ed3bdb567db7206e4063d01cfd96916d6 OP_EQUAL
address
32amX5ZewiQ4ka67fCoqp6RN4ZYhpX3HgS
transaction
6a066468edcae42fc3184527618fa1ef80339b84a6dc4f536d05beae69cf47a4
confirmations
401822
spent
true